Centralina Workforce Development Board
L A B O RMARKET OVERVIEW
June 2020 May 2020 April 2020 June 2019
Anson
Labor Force 10,252 10,382 10,067 10,753Employed 9,446 9,312 9,238 10,286
Unemployed 806 1,070 829 467
Rate 7.9 10.3 8.2 4.3
Cabarrus
Labor Force 104,490 104,652 100,865 110,419
Employed 96,372 91,663 88,588 106,249
Unemployed 8,118 12,989 12,277 4,170
Rate 7.8 12.4 12.2 3.8
Iredell
Labor Force 85,863 86,948 84,598 90,623
Employed 79,049 75,171 72,664 87,149
Unemployed 6,814 11,777 11,934 3,474
Rate 7.9 13.5 14.1 3.8
lincoln
Labor Force 41,240 41,663 40,460 44,045
Employed 38,445 36,507 35,305 42,373
Unemployed 2,795 5,156 5,155 1,672
Rate 6.8 12.4 12.7 3.8
Rowan
Labor Force 63,613 64,863 62,400 67,033
Employed 58,243 55,352 53,523 64,205
Unemployed 5,370 9,511 8,877 2,828
Rate 8.4 14.7 14.2 4.2
stanly
Labor Force 29,918 30,202 29,180 30,627
Employed 28,025 27,111 26,304 29,418
Unemployed 1,893 3,091 2,876 1,209
Rate 6.3 10.2 9.9 3.9
Union
Labor Force 116,928 115,948 112,143 125,444
Employed 109,533 104,096 100,676 120,746
Unemployed 7,395 11,852 11,467 4,698
Rate 6.3 10.2 10.2 3.7
Civilian labor Force Estimates*
